College and Academic Counseling

The College and Academic Counselors (CACs) collaborate in the development and delivery of college application materials, financial aid, and college admission testing, as well as all course selection and scheduling processes, academic counseling, and intervention programs. CACs also serve on a support team with other academic, residential, and student life members.

The college planning process at IMSA is comprised of individual meetings with students and research tools.

Financial aid plays a central and essential role in supporting post-secondary education by providing money for college to eligible students and families.
